when you choose Custom_Continents a new option will be added at the bottom (after sea level, temperature etc), which is how many continents you want in your game. You can choose random (but this is pointless since it will be the same as the normal Continents map), a number of your choice or 1 continent for each team. This last option, as anticipated by Morgan, doesn't seem to work well. In my current game, I started with 4 teams of 2 players and chose one continent per team. Instead we are 2 teams on the same continent.

BLOODYBATTLEBRA, you can't choose the amount of Civs you are up against in "Play Now!" -- instead go to "Custom Game" and change some of the AI players from AI to Closed. This removes the player from the game.
